Corning® Collagen I, Bovine, 30 mg
PU: Unit
Corning® Collagen I, bovine, 30mg, is used either as a thin layer on tissue-culture surfaces to enhance cell attachment and proliferation, or as a gel to promote expression of cell-specific morphology and function. (Same as Cat. #40231)
Source
Bovine dermis
Quality
- Purity > 95% by SDS-PAGE
- Shown to promote attachment and spreading of HT-1080 human fibrosarcoma cells
- Tested for formation of a firm gel by exposure to ammonia vapors from solutions of 0.5 mg/ mL. Further dilution will decrease the rigidity of the gel. NOTE: This preparation contains native collagen molecules with a small amount of nicked or shortened sequences due to pepsin treatment.
- Tested and found negative for bacteria, fungi, and mycoplasma
Formulation
Liquid in 0.012 N HCl
Preparation and Storage
Stable for at least three months at 2° to 8°C. Do not freeze.
Handling
Effective as a gel or thin coating at a recommended concentration of 5-10 µg/cm² of growth surface depending on cell type
Corning extracellular matrices (ECMs) enable researchers to mimic in vivo environments for 2D and 3D cell culture applications.
Corning offers a broad range of collagen types that are derived from multiple species. These collagens have been used to culture a variety of cell types to promote adhesion, growth, and/or differentiation.
